About This Item
Grosset & Dunlap, 1954 Bound in blue tweed. Verso of half title, rear jacket flap and cover list to itself. Jacket with tiny tears at top front and front fold, nicks at spine extremities and a bit of wrinkling on the back bottom.Lihgt pencil ownership on front flap.
